Fighting Eviction

2012
This book discusses two development themes: the land and housing rights of India’s Adivasi, and methods for engaging marginalized people in action research. It focuses on a concrete problem –enclosure and eviction of the Katkari, a primitive forest tribe, from their rural hamlets on the plains of Maharashtra.

Evicted!

2009
Evicted! is a practical and critical look at the vulnerability of Americans’ property rights to eminent domain abuse since the Supreme Court’s 2005 Kelo decision. The 2005 Supreme Court decision Kelo v. City of New London, which upheld the taking of an individual’s home by local government for the sake of private development, unleashed a ...
